Tethya leysae is a species of sea sponge belonging to the family Tethyidae, found in the Canadian north-west Pacific. It was first described by Heim and Nickel in 2010, from specimens collected by Sally P. Leys from a rocky bottom substrate near Ohiat Island, British Columbia in 2003 and 2006. The species epithet honours Sally P. Leys.
